Line cutting, IP, and geological mapping programs have commenced to define targets for subsequent exploration programs.\nThe Skead project covers an area of 972 ha approximately 120km SE of Timmins and approximately 15km South of Larder Lake Ontario. The project includes the past producing New Telluride gold mine which last saw production around 1932 during which time a two compartment shaft was sunk to 375 feet, with 1,995 feet of lateral development on levels at 90, 150, 250, and 350 feet. A 50 ton/day mill was installed which reportedly ceased operation due to a fire in 1932 and was never successfully rebuilt. Reference to past production reports gold values from trace to 1 oz/ton from underground workings.\nThe project is located within the Archean Abitibi Greenstone Belt of the Superior Province of the Canadian Shield. The claims are primarily underlain by sequences of fragmental lavas, pyroclastics and minor interbeds of sediments. Alteration of albitization surrounds many of the mineralized areas and a northerly trending major fault is projected adjacent to most of these mineralized zones. A diabase unit appears to contain green speckles (fucsite?).\nMost of the zones contain shear and fracture controlled lenses containing quartz veins and stringers, carbonate, pyrite, chalcopyrite and widespread specularite. The gold tends to follow copper to some extent.\nThe focus of the project is its three primary zones which trend northeast of the New Telluride shaft area: the Telluride, Denique, and Northern zones.
